Multi-award winning horror podcast featuring creepy stories with full audio production written by Black writers and performed by Black actors. So scary it’ll make you want to leave your night light on.

Enjoy episode 1 of Visionaries. In 2185, the world is distinguished by two races: The Dead-eyes and the Visionaries. Visionaries are the next step in human evolution. They are born with unique eyes, giving them superhuman abilities. However, humans born with normal eyes are labeled as Dead-eyes. The disparity in power leads to the enslavement of all Dead-eyes.
